欢迎阅读《pythonista周刊》第448期。Let us start!

原文: https://mailchi.mp/pythonweekly/python-weekly-issue-448
翻译:Dustyposa

来自赞助商(PS:原文的赞助商): 使用 Datadog 监控你的python指标,日志,集群分析。使用Datadog的应用分析,可以深入任何纬度并且能找到你所需要的信息,来进行动态诊断和快速故障排除。来免费试用 14 天吧!

新鲜事

Python 开发者调查 2019 结果公示 来自 150 个国家的超过 24,000 名 Python 用户参加了今年 11 月的调查。在收集到的数据的帮助下,我们将结果进行展示,找到流行的趋势并创建一个 Python 开发档案。

文章、教程与话题

Machine Learning & Deep Learning Fundamentals 本系列为初学者介绍了深度学习和神经网络的基本概念。除了这些概念,我们也会展示使用 Keras 在代码中实现了一些概念,一个用 Python 写的神经网络的 API。我们将学习关于人工神经网络的中 layers(层)activation functions(激活函数)backpropagation(反向传播)convolutional neural networks(CNNs)data augmentation(数据增强)transfer learning(迁移学习)以及其他知识!

Calculating Streaks in Pandas 这篇教程教你如何在 pandas 库中计算 calculate streaks 并使用 Matplotlib 进行可视化。使用的是 NBA 季后赛投篮数据。

TLDR: 编写一个 Slack bot 来总结文章 使用顶尖 NLP 技术来更多更快的阅读新闻。这篇文章概述了如何将一个顶尖的机器学习模型集成到 Slack bot 来生成一份文章总结,并分享它们的 URL - a.k.a "tldr"(太长,不要读)

The future of Python img(33 min 27 sec) 随着企业对机器学习的重视程度的提高,人们也看到了对 Python 的兴趣再次兴起。是什么让 Python 与其他语言不同?有什么特性让 Python 与众不同?Python 将往何处发展?在这一集中,我们的播客与来自 ThoughtWorks 巴西 Luciano Ramalho ---一位著名的 Python 书籍作者---聊了很多关于 dunder 方法、快速失败和即将出版的第二版 Fluent Python 的新书。

如何使用 Django and Stripe 创建一个 Subscription SaaS Application 软件即服务(SaaS) 订阅服务是目前世界上发展最快的业务。每天,开发者和有抱负的企业家都在想构建一种新的订阅 SaaS 产品的代码。但是这些应用到底是什么样子的呢?这篇指南将覆盖所有使用 Django and Stripe 创建一个 subscription SaaS business 的技术细节。

用 bash and Python 3 进行系统编程 系统管理员在命令行上花费大量的时间,所以他们想用命令行的语言来自动化完成任务?—?就像 bash or Powershell。虽然可以用这些语言编写很多游泳的程序,一个更高等级的语言比如 Python 可能是更好的选择,特别是考虑到 Python 程序可以在系统直接在 bash(例如: LInux or Mac) 以及 Powershell(Window) 上进行移植。作为一个练习,让我们编写一个 head commandbash 实现,然后我们将对比我们可以在 Python 中如何实现。

RSVP for the ONLY Python Web Conference (Virtual) | June 17-19, 2020

Experts discuss hard web production problems. 40+ talks on Django, Plone, CI/CD, Containers, Serverless, REST APIs, microservices, etc. Join JetBrains and Six Feet Up to discuss what the future holds. SPONSOR

Python and Z3 解决 Binary Puzzles

在这篇文章中,我们将看一下我们可以如何使用 Python and Z3 Theorem Prover 制作一个计算机程序来解决随机的 Binary Puzzles

如何使用 Bamboolib 在 Data Science 中进行数据整理 img(14min)

这个视频向你展示了如何使用 Bamboolib 库在你的 Data Science 项目中完成数据整理。我们不需要手动编写 Pandas 语法,我们仍然会使用 Bamboolib 图形式用户界面来利用 Pandas 来完成这些任务。

COVID-19: 使用 OpenCV, Keras/TensorFlow, and Deep Learning进行口罩人脸识别

在这篇指南中,你讲学习到如何使用 OpenCV、Keras/TensorFlow and Deep Learning 训练一个 COVID-19 口罩人脸识别器。

Generating Melodies with LSTM Nets: Series Overview img(16min)

在这个系列,我们将会构建一个能够自动产生旋律的 Long Short-Term Memory Network 。在这个过程中,我们将学习 Keras、时间序列数据以及 symbolic music representations

Django Testing Cheat Sheet

Django 应用程序中常见测试模式和最佳实践的速查表。

用户和表单交互

在之前的了解 Django 的文章中,我们看到了 Django 模版是如何生成一个用户界面的。如果你仅仅是仅需要展示一个用户界面,那是很棒的,但是你如果需要你的网站和用户交互,应该怎么办?使用 Django 的表单系统!在这篇文章中,我们将聚焦于如何使用 Django表单系统 来让 web forms 工作的。

如何用Python下载股票基本面数据?

学习如何用 yahoo_fin packagePython 中去下载基本面数据,包括 P/E and P/S 比率,股票回报率及其他。

用 Django and Vue.js 构建 SaaS img(25min)

在本系列视频中,学习如何从零开始构建 SaaS

在 Flask 中用 Flask-Login 处理用户账户以及用户认证

通过支持用户账户创建一个交互式 Flask 应用!处理账户创建,登录,限定内容和用户特色功能。

利用线性编程设计能源套利策略

本帖的目标是说明如何利用线性编程的数学优化技术,在已知未来价格的假设下,在给定的运行约束条件下,设计一个并网电池的运行策略。所有这些都将使用现实世界的能源价格数据和 Python 中的开源工具来完成。

使用 Python 生成超过 10,000 个独特的 8 位光剑 以下是如何使用 Python、PillowTweepy 来创建自己的 8 位光剑艺术。

真 无限剑制

为 Python 开发探寻 Jupyter 笔记本的替代方案

Jupyter 笔记本文件格式有一些缺点,可以通过 Jupyter 代码单元和 VS 代码交互 Python 来缓解。本文将描述如何使用这些工具。

GeoHealth: Build-up and Architecture 或者如何从头零始构建 Python 仪表板。

Python 的函数工具模块简介

用实际例子介绍 functools 函数。

建立你自己的“谷歌翻译”——高质量的机器翻译系统

在不注销用户的情况下更改/旋转 Django 密钥!

Variations on the Death of Python 2

53 个 Python 面试问题及答案

有趣的项目、工具和库

FunctionTrace

一个图形化的 Python 分析器,它提供了一个清晰的应用程序执行情况,同时低开销和易于使用。

看起来相当美观

image.png

Airshare

Airshare 是一个基于 PythonCLI 工具和模块,让你在两台机器在一个局域网或者 P2P 之间传输数据,用的是 Multicast-DNS。它还可以为其他非 CLI 外部接口打开一个HTTP网关。它可以完全离线工作! 用 aiohttpzeroconf 构建。

Potassium40

一个基于并行的 AWS Lambda 函数的应用级扫描仪!

jukebox

一个在 raw audio domain 生成歌唱音乐的模型。

MlFinlab

MlFinlab 是一个 Python 包,通过提供可重现、可解释和易于使用的工具,帮助投资组合经理和交易员利用机器学习的力量。

Slackify 用于快速开发现代的 Slack bots 的轻量级框架。

interrogate interrogate 检查你的代码库中是否有缺失的 docstrings

AIIM 我有会议吗?当您参加 Zoom/Teams 会议时,通知其他人。

Scrabble 一款严格意义上的多人拼写游戏,用 ReactFlask 制作。

GIMP-ML 一套用于 GIMP 的机器学习 Python 插件。

Pydantic-SQLAlchemySQLAlchemy 模型生成 Pydantic 模型的工具。

kiss-headers 用于面向对象的头文件、httpimapPython 包。将头文件解析为对象。

YouTube2Audio 一个桌面应用程序,可将 YouTube 视频下载为 YouTubeMP4 文件。

最近更新

TensorFlow 2.2.0 TensorFlow 2.2 停止了对 Python 2 的支持。与此变化相呼应的是,TensorFlow 的新发布的 Docker 镜像完全提供了 Python 3。由于所有镜像现在都使用 Python 3,所以包含 -py3 的 Docker 标记将不再提供,现有的 -py3 标记(如 latest-py3)将不会更新。请查看发布说明,了解这个版本中的其他功能和改进。

Python 3.8.3rc1

Django bugfix release: 3.0.6

那些活动

Virtual: San Francisco Python Meetup May 2020 将会有以下话题: - Pants 构建系统如何利用 Python 3 的特性 - 一个在计算机实验室管理一个班级学生的Web应用程序 - 机器学习模型部署的开放标准 - 构建一个自动交易机器人

Virtual: Austin Python Meetup May 2020 将会有以下话题:

  • 利用 Folium 使用 Python 制作交互式地图
  • 使用超参数调优

Virtual: PyMNtos Python Presentation Night #84 将会有以下话题:

  • Python FlaskReact 设置为前端
  • Python 设计模式

Virtual: IndyPy Mixer: Basics of Python 将有一个讲座,从想法到应用。清晰抽象和入门。教学应用开发教会了我什么。

Virtual: Logging in Python with Mike Driscoll 在我们5月的会议上,Python 作者 Mike Driscoll 将为我们介绍 Python 中的日志,包括不同级别的日志,使用多个处理程序,格式化你的日志等等。

Virtual: Building your Data Science Career 小组讨论,内容包括如何找到你的第一份 DS 工作,对DS职位的面试有何期待,在 DS 角色中成长,几年后的数据科学领域会是什么样子等。

Posa:

❤️ Happy Pythonic ;-(Posa私人无责任播报)

----- 分割线 -----

如果你发现哪里翻译有误的话,请务与我联系!感谢!


Comments


大妈的多重宇宙 - YouTube

全新自媒体系列...科学幻想,读书,说故事...
点击注册~> 获得 100$ 体验券: DigitalOcean Referral Badge

订阅 substack 体验古早写作:
Zoom.Quiet’s Chaos42 | Substack


关注公众号, 持续获得相关各种嗯哼:
zoomquiet


蟒营®编程思维提高班Python版

**2021.01.11** 因大妈再次创业暂停定期开设, 转换为预约触发:
  • + 任何问题, 随时邮件提问可也:
    askdama@googlegroups.com
-->